Ocean Tides Hillside is listed under School and is located at Providence, Rhode Island.
Business Description :
Address : 20 Hillside Ave Providence, RI 02906-2916
City : Providence
Pin Code : 2906
Phone : (401) 453-2628
E-mail :
Website :
Service Area Category : School in Providence - 2906
Category : School in Providence
Services : School